WHAT DOES THIS COMPANY DO?
MSC Industrial Direct Co., Inc. What it actually does.

Distributes metalworking products Distributes maintenance, repair, and operations (MRO) products Now — the numbers.

on the stock market since 1995
7,181 employees
$6.7B market value
Revenue last year:
$3.8B
The net profit left over:
$199.3M
Out of every $100 in sales, $5 stays as net profit.
THE SLICE THAT TURNS INTO PROFIT: 5%

This is an established company with proven profits.

Cash on hand:
$56.2M
Total debt:
$538.8M
The debt outweighs the cash.

The gap is $482.6M. In times of high interest rates, a gap like that can squeeze a company.
